Front License Plate?

How do you guys mount the front license plate? I don't want to drill a hole into my car but can only find the no hole tow hook package for MB sedan.

Any suggestion? I live in Seattle where front license plate is required by the law.

I just drilled a couple of small holes in the bumper. If you cannot bear to do this, I'd recommend getting some very strong magnets from a magnet supplier and place these on the inside of the bumper. Then, add heavy steel washers to the license plate holder and use the magnets to draw it in place. You will probably want to put some plastic sheet between the washers and the bumper to prevent marring the paint. This is a real pain to do, but it is the only alternative I know of to drilling holes.

Another possibility that I just thought of would be to utilize the tow hook threaded hole as a base for a license plate holder. This would probably take some license plate holder customizing, and would require a length of all thread rod threaded for the tow hook holder, but it would work. It certainly would not be pedestrian friendly, but it would meet your state's laws requiring a front plate.
